本発明は、野菜、果物等の食品の包装出荷前等に行なわれる最終洗浄等での作業者の手洗い工程、あるいはその他の電子、機械部品、産業部品、産業機器等の洗浄工程において使用される手洗いによる洗浄機に関する。 INDUSTRIAL APPLICABILITY The present invention is used in an operator's hand washing process in final washing or the like performed before packaging and shipment of food such as vegetables and fruits, or in other electronic, mechanical parts, industrial parts, industrial equipment washing processes, etc. It relates to a washing machine by hand washing.

野菜、果物その他の食品等に関しては人の体内に直接に取り込まれるものである点から、食品衛生上の厳格な管理が必要とされており、その洗浄を行なう装置として種々のものが提案されている。一般的な野菜等の洗浄装置としては、水槽内に搬送用コンベアを配置し、該コンベアの搬送面の上方位置に払拭用布や板ブラシ、回転ブラシ等の洗浄機構を設置して野菜等の表面に付着した汚れや付着物等を除去するものがある。 Vegetables, fruits and other foods are taken directly into the human body, and therefore strict food hygiene management is required, and various devices have been proposed for cleaning them. Yes. As a general vegetable cleaning device, a conveyor for transportation is placed in the water tank, and a cleaning mechanism such as a wiping cloth, a plate brush, or a rotating brush is installed above the transport surface of the conveyor. There are some that remove dirt and deposits attached to the surface.

従来の装置は、野菜類等を多量に処理するために専用のコンベアラインを水中に配置し槽の底部からエアレーションを行って上昇空気により洗浄対象物の表面に付着した異物等を除去するものであり、大型で高価であって、しかも収穫後の土や包装紙等が表面に付着した状態のものの一次洗浄用として使用されるものがほとんどであった。これに対し、出願人は、例えば特開2003−9834号において、コンベヤの配置と駆動方向に着目して毛髪または異物等の除去を確実に行える装置を提案した。
特開2003−9834号(明細書の特許請求の範囲、図1)
Conventional devices are designed to remove foreign substances attached to the surface of the object to be cleaned by rising air by placing a dedicated conveyor line in the water in order to process a large amount of vegetables, etc., aerating from the bottom of the tank. Most of them are large and expensive, and are used for primary cleaning in a state in which soil or wrapping paper after harvesting is attached to the surface. On the other hand, for example, in Japanese Patent Application Laid-Open No. 2003-9834, the applicant has proposed an apparatus that can reliably remove hair or foreign matters by paying attention to the arrangement and driving direction of the conveyor.
JP2003-9834 (Claims of the specification, FIG. 1)

上記の特開2003−9834号の装置では、投入する根菜類等についての人毛を含む異物についてはこれを効果的に除去することが可能である。しかしながら、この装置では大根、なすび、きゅうり等のいわゆる根物やある程度の大きさのブロック状の品物の場合にはコンベア搬送により連続洗浄が可能であるが、野沢菜、高菜、白菜等の葉物の洗浄についてはこの装置を使用しても効果的な洗浄を望めないおそれがある。また、この特許文献の装置は、搬送コンベアを搭載し、ある程度高価であった。また、葉物野菜等は葉と葉との間に砂や土を噛んでいる場合があり、そのまま包装出荷した場合に消費過程で発見されて全ロットが返品とされ、かつ、当該生産者の企業生命にも影響を与える点は、近時の例に見られる。また、人毛等が挟み込まれて付着した場合にはその除去が極めて困難であり、大規模処理の装置ではいったん付着が離れて浮遊する毛髪等が再付着するおそれがある。さらに、果菜類のなかで葉物等を効果的に洗浄する装置であって、零細規模の生産者あるいは加工業者が簡易に入手可能な程度の低コストの装置が今までになく、よって、そのような装置の出現が待望されていた。 In the apparatus disclosed in Japanese Patent Application Laid-Open No. 2003-9834, it is possible to effectively remove foreign matters including human hair for root vegetables to be input. However, in this device, in the case of so-called roots such as radish, eggplant, cucumber, etc., and block-shaped items of a certain size, continuous washing is possible by conveyor conveyance. There is a possibility that effective cleaning cannot be expected even if this apparatus is used. Moreover, the apparatus of this patent document is equipped with a conveyor and is expensive to some extent. In addition, leafy vegetables, etc., sometimes have sand or soil bitten between the leaves, and when they are packaged and shipped, they are discovered during the consumption process and all lots are returned. The impact on corporate life can be seen in recent examples. Further, when human hair or the like is pinched and attached, it is extremely difficult to remove the hair, and in a large-scale treatment apparatus, there is a possibility that the attached hair is once separated and the floating hair or the like is attached again. Furthermore, there is an apparatus for effectively washing leaves and the like in fruit vegetables, which has never been low-cost equipment that can be easily obtained by a small-scale producer or processor. The emergence of such a device was awaited.

以下、添付図面を参照しつつ本発明の果菜食品等の手洗い機の実施の形態について説明する。本発明に係る果菜食品等の手洗い機は、例えば包装出荷前の最終洗浄工程等に適用され、根物だけでなく、特に葉物の果菜食品洗浄を確実に行える手洗いによる装置である。 Hereinafter, embodiments of a hand washing machine for fruit and vegetable foods of the present invention will be described with reference to the accompanying drawings. The hand-washing machine for fruit and vegetable foods according to the present invention is an apparatus by hand washing that can be applied to, for example, the final washing process before package shipment, and can reliably wash not only roots but also leafy fruit and vegetable foods.

実施形態Embodiment

図1ないし図6は、本発明の実施形態に係る果菜食品等の手洗い機10を示しており、図1において、果菜食品等の手洗い機10は、手洗い槽12と、捕集機構42と、噴射手段14と、放出部16と、循環機構18と、を備えている。 1 to 6 show a hand washing machine 10 for fruit and vegetable foods according to an embodiment of the present invention. In FIG. 1, the hand washing machine 10 for fruit and vegetable foods includes a hand washing tank 12, a collection mechanism 42, The injection means 14, the discharge | release part 16, and the circulation mechanism 18 are provided.

手洗い槽12は、本発明の果菜食品等の手洗い機10のうちの構造上の主要な部分であり、図2に示すように、例えば人が機体の前に立って作業しうる作業高さに設定され、かつ、その内部で例えば漬物用の高菜漬けや野沢菜漬けを含む葉物や根菜類等の1本もの、あるいはそれをブロック状に切断した食品を手揉み洗いし得る程度の深さを有する槽体からなる。実施形態において、手洗い槽12は、例えばケース状の金属機枠20に支持されて上面を開口し底壁22及び四周壁24a〜24dを有するステンレス製等の立体矩形槽体から形成され、図上、左右方向に長い立体長矩形形状で構成され、対向壁24bがその両側に隅部241A、241Bを有する隅部体構造、すなわち槽の一端側が箱体形状となっており、簡単に製造しうるようになっている。機枠20に支持されてこの手洗い槽12に隣接してバッファ槽15が設けられている。手洗い槽12の一対の対向壁のうち一方の壁24aには洗浄水の噴射手段14が設けられるとともに、これに対向する壁24bには放出部16が設けられている。 The hand-washing tank 12 is the main structural part of the hand-washing machine 10 such as fruit vegetable food of the present invention. As shown in FIG. 2, the hand-washing tank 12 has a working height at which a person can work while standing in front of the machine. Depth that is set and that can be washed by hand in one of the leaves, root vegetables, etc. containing pickled takana pickles and picked nozawana pickles, or food that has been cut into blocks. It consists of a tank body having. In the embodiment, the hand-washing tank 12 is formed of a three-dimensional rectangular tank body made of stainless steel or the like that is supported by a case-like metal machine frame 20 and has an upper surface opened and a bottom wall 22 and four peripheral walls 24a to 24d. The corner wall structure is formed in a solid rectangular shape that is long in the left-right direction, and the opposing wall 24b has corner portions 241A and 241B on both sides thereof, that is, one end side of the tank has a box shape and can be easily manufactured. It is like that. A buffer tank 15 is provided adjacent to the hand washing tank 12 supported by the machine frame 20. Of the pair of opposing walls of the hand-washing tub 12, one of the walls 24a is provided with the washing water jetting means 14, and the opposite wall 24b is provided with the discharge portion 16.

実施形態において図2に示すように、底壁2は、水の流れF方向に向けて下流側に下がり傾斜となる傾斜部221と、傾斜部221の傾斜端に接続され対向壁24bに至るまで平坦状に形成された平坦部222と、を含む。底壁に傾斜部221を含むことにより対向壁24bに当たった後の水が手洗い槽内で対流あるいは循環流となり、水の噴射側へ異物が戻ることが防止され、かつ、そのような対流あるいは循環流を生じにくくしうる。 As shown in FIG. 2 in the embodiment, the bottom wall 2 2, an inclined portion 221 to be inclined downward to the downstream side toward the flow direction F of the water, is connected to the inclined end of the inclined portion 221 reaches the opposite wall 24b And a flat portion 222 formed so as to be flat. By including the inclined portion 221 in the bottom wall, the water after hitting the opposing wall 24b becomes a convection or circulation flow in the hand-washing tank, and foreign matter is prevented from returning to the water injection side, and such convection or Circulation flow can be made difficult to occur.

噴射手段14は、手洗い槽12の一端側から対向壁側に向けて洗浄水を横方向に噴射する手段であり、手洗い槽12内に図上左から右方向に一方向の速い流速の水の流れを生起させつつ槽内での葉物等の手揉み洗浄作業時に付着した異物を洗い落とす。本実施形態において、噴射手段14は右方向に向けて開口したノズル26を有する噴射管28を含む。特に、本実施形態では一端壁側から各隅部241A、241B方向に交差状となるようにそれぞれ噴射方向を向けた交差噴射ノズル26a、26bが設けられ図1に示すように対向壁24bの面に対して隅部から正面部分に至る全面に向けて水の流れを生じさせ槽体内部での対流あるいは循環流発生を防止する。本実施形態では、一対の交差噴射ノズル26a、26bは、底壁22の傾斜部221の傾斜終端部寄りに配置され対向壁24bの手前部分でそれぞれの噴射ノズル26a、26bからの噴射水が衝突してある程度の乱流となりつつ対向壁24bの略全面に当たるように設定されている。さらに、この実施形態では、底壁の平坦部222に接しながら該平坦部と平行に流れる流れの噴射水となるようにそれぞれの交差噴射ノズル26a、26bが設けられている。これらの交差噴射ノズル26a、26bは交差方向に噴出するためには最低一対が必要であるが、ノズルの数自体は一対の設置が確保されていれば、その他は任意の数で設定しても良い。さらに、本実施形態では一端壁24aに互いに平行に対向壁24bに向かうように他の噴射ノズル30a、30bが設けられ、一端壁24aから対向壁24bに向けての平行な噴射水流を生起させている。これらの平行噴射ノズル30a、30bは、交差噴射ノズル26a、26bよりも高位置に設定されており、実施形態ではこれらの平行噴射ノズル30a、30bの口縁高さと略同じ高さ位置に後述するオーバフロー位置が設定されている。なお、32は、水補充用の管である。 The jetting means 14 is a means for jetting cleaning water laterally from one end side of the hand-washing tank 12 toward the opposite wall side, and into the hand-washing tank 12 water having a fast flow rate in one direction from left to right in the figure. Washing off foreign matter adhering during manual scrubbing such as leaves in the tank while causing flow. In the present embodiment, the injection means 14 includes an injection pipe 28 having a nozzle 26 that opens to the right. In particular, in the present embodiment, cross-injection nozzles 26a and 26b each having an injection direction directed so as to cross each corner 241A and 241B from one end wall side are provided, and the surface of the opposing wall 24b as shown in FIG. On the other hand, the flow of water is generated toward the entire surface from the corner portion to the front portion, thereby preventing the generation of convection or circulation in the tank body. In the present embodiment, the pair of cross injection nozzles 26a and 26b are arranged near the inclined end portion of the inclined portion 221 of the bottom wall 22, and the water injected from the respective injection nozzles 26a and 26b collides with the front portion of the opposing wall 24b. Thus, the turbulent flow is set so as to hit almost the entire surface of the facing wall 24b while generating a certain degree of turbulent flow. Furthermore, in this embodiment, each cross injection nozzle 26a, 26b is provided so that it may become the injection water of the flow which flows in parallel with this flat part, contacting the flat part 222 of a bottom wall. These cross-jet nozzle 26a, 26b are in order to jet the cross direction is required minimum pair, if the number itself of the nozzle if a pair of installation is ensured, other than that set in any number Also good. Furthermore, in this embodiment, the other injection nozzles 30a and 30b are provided on the one end wall 24a so as to be parallel to each other toward the opposing wall 24b, and a parallel jet water flow from the one end wall 24a toward the opposing wall 24b is generated. Yes. These parallel injection nozzles 30a and 30b are set at higher positions than the cross injection nozzles 26a and 26b. In the embodiment, the parallel injection nozzles 30a and 30b will be described later at substantially the same height as the edge height of the parallel injection nozzles 30a and 30b. Overflow position is set. Reference numeral 32 denotes a water replenishment pipe.

放出部16は、噴射手段14から噴射された洗浄水を手洗い槽12外に放出させる放出手段であり、実施形態において対向壁24b側に設けられたオーバフロー部34と、スリット孔36と、を含む。オーバフロー部34は、対向壁24bの上端部に設置され溢流方向にせり上がり拡大した溢流促進壁38を有している。液面に浮遊する軽比重の異物はこの溢流促進壁38を介してバッファ槽15側に溢流し金網等の多数の孔を有するフィルタケース40により捕集される。溢流促進壁38の両端側には水の流れを中央側に集めるための変向板41が下流側に向けて水流幅を狭くするように斜めに設けられている。スリット孔36は、横方向に長い孔であり対向壁であって底壁の幅方向中央位置に配置され、砂成分等の大きな比重の成分の異物を手洗い槽外部に排出させる。スリット孔36のスリット幅は例えば0.5mm〜数ミリメートル程度の孔で長さは任意に設定してよい。手洗い槽の底壁部分の高圧側から底部付近に存在する異物はスリット孔36を介して排出される。 The discharge unit 16 is a discharge unit that discharges the cleaning water sprayed from the spray unit 14 to the outside of the hand-washing tub 12 , and includes an overflow unit 34 provided on the opposite wall 24b side and a slit hole 36 in the embodiment. . The overflow portion 34 has an overflow promoting wall 38 that is installed at the upper end portion of the opposing wall 24b and that rises and expands in the overflow direction. The light specific gravity foreign matter floating on the liquid surface overflows to the buffer tank 15 side through the overflow promoting wall 38 and is collected by the filter case 40 having a large number of holes such as a wire mesh. On both end sides of the overflow promoting wall 38, direction plates 41 for collecting the water flow toward the center are provided obliquely so as to narrow the water flow width toward the downstream side. The slit hole 36 is a hole that is long in the horizontal direction and is disposed at the center position in the width direction of the bottom wall as a facing wall, and discharges foreign substances having a large specific gravity component such as a sand component to the outside of the hand-washing tub. The slit width of the slit hole 36 is a hole of about 0.5 mm to several millimeters, for example, and the length may be arbitrarily set. Foreign matter existing in the vicinity of the bottom from the high pressure side of the bottom wall portion of the hand-washing tank is discharged through the slit hole 36.

図2において、バッファ槽15は、手洗い槽12から放出された水をいったん収集し循環ポンプ側に還流させる槽であり、実施形態においてバッファ槽の高さ中間位置に金網等の多孔捕集手段42設けて上下に分割し下位室152には循環機構の吸引部を配置させるとともに、上位室151は手洗い槽の放出部16からの放出水を受けてこれを多孔捕集手段42を介して下位室152側に流し放出部16から異物が排出された場合にはこの多孔捕集手段42により捕集し、最終的にこれを除去する。実施形態において、上位室151は底壁を金網で構成した上面開口のケース体から形成されており該ケース体は、受部43により受けられて該上位室に出し入れ自在に設けられている。ケース体の上部には取っ手45が取り付けられている。なお、この上位室151には対向壁24bの外面から突出し、前記したスリット孔の開口下縁から傾斜下方に伸びるスリット孔受け47が取り付けられており、スリット孔36から排出される異物を金網の中央側に誘導して放出させ対向壁24bの外面などに付着しないようにしている。下位室152には水位を保持するための開閉コック付きオーバフロー管44が設けられるとともに、同じく開閉コックつきの排水管46が配置されている。 In FIG. 2, the buffer tank 15 is a tank that once collects the water discharged from the hand-washing tank 12 and recirculates it to the circulation pump side. In the embodiment, the porous collecting means 42 such as a wire net is provided at the middle position of the buffer tank. The lower chamber 152 is provided with a suction part of the circulation mechanism, and the upper chamber 151 receives water discharged from the discharge portion 16 of the hand-washing tank and passes it through the porous collection means 42. When foreign matter is discharged from the discharge portion 16 by flowing toward the 152 side, it is collected by the porous collecting means 42 and finally removed. In the embodiment, the upper chamber 151 is formed from a case body having an upper surface opening whose bottom wall is made of a metal mesh, and the case body is received by the receiving portion 43 and is provided so as to be freely inserted into and removed from the upper chamber. A handle 45 is attached to the upper part of the case body. The upper chamber 151 is provided with a slit hole receiver 47 that protrudes from the outer surface of the opposing wall 24b and extends downward from the lower edge of the slit hole. The foreign matter discharged from the slit hole 36 is made of metal mesh. It is guided and discharged to the center side so as not to adhere to the outer surface of the opposing wall 24b. The lower chamber 152 is provided with an overflow pipe 44 with an open / close cock for maintaining the water level, and a drain pipe 46 with an open / close cock is also provided.

循環機構18は、バッファ槽15内に放出された水を収集して噴射ノズル26,30に圧送供給し放出部からの水を再び噴射手段14から洗浄水として噴射させる水循環手段であり、本実施形態において、循環機構18は、下位室152の水を戻す戻し管48と戻し管に連通接続されたポンプ50と、ポンプ50に連通接続されそれぞれの噴射ノズル26,30から高圧水を噴射させる噴射管28と、を備えている。戻し管48の先端は下位室152内に突出しその突出端に脱着可能なフィルタキャップ52が取り付けられている。 The circulation mechanism 18 is a water circulation means that collects the water discharged into the buffer tank 15 and pumps and supplies the water to the injection nozzles 26 and 30 to inject the water from the discharge portion again as cleaning water from the injection means 14. In the embodiment, the circulation mechanism 18 includes a return pipe 48 for returning water of the lower chamber 152, a pump 50 connected to the return pipe, and an injection for injecting high-pressure water from the injection nozzles 26, 30 connected to the pump 50. A tube 28. The tip of the return pipe 48 protrudes into the lower chamber 152, and a removable filter cap 52 is attached to the protruding end.

なお、図中54、56は、それぞれカバー板であり、カバー板54は、手洗い槽の噴射手段取り付け側を、カバー板56は、バッファ槽15側の上方を被覆する。58,60はキャスタであり、後部側のキャスタ58は機枠20に対して着地高さが調整自在となっている。   In the figure, 54 and 56 are cover plates, respectively, the cover plate 54 covers the spraying device mounting side of the hand-washing tank, and the cover plate 56 covers the upper side of the buffer tank 15 side. 58 and 60 are casters, and the landing height of the casters 58 on the rear side is adjustable with respect to the machine casing 20.

次に、図5をも参照して実施形態の果菜食品等の手洗い機の作用について説明すると、図示しないスイッチボックスの始動スイッチをオンして吸引圧送装置としてのポンプ50を駆動しそれぞれのノズル26、30から洗浄水Wを横方向に噴出させる。手洗い槽12内では図1に示すように交差噴射ノズル26a、26bからの噴射洗浄水が底壁上面に接するように噴出される。そして対向壁24bの手前側で衝突して乱流状態となり対向壁24bの内面側の略全面に流れが当たる。したがって、この対向壁24bに当たる流れはある程度エネルギーを消耗して水面付近の水はオーバフロー部34から、底壁付近の水はスリット孔36からバッファ槽15側に放出される。さらに、実施形態では平行噴射ノズル30a、30bにより水面付近を平行に対向壁24bに向けて噴出させる流れが作られており、これによって、一方向流を強化している。そして、滞留や循環流を手洗い槽内に形成させることなく一方向への速い流れを槽内に作ることができる。この状態で例えば葉物野菜を手洗い槽12内に漬けた状態で例えば手揉み洗いすると確実に異物を水流で引き離すとともに、軽比重の水面に浮遊しやすい毛髪や藻類R異物はオーバフロー部34から溢流排出し、同時に比較的に大きな比重の例えば砂粒S等の異物は底壁付近に存在してスリット孔36から確実にバッファ槽側に排出される。そして、バッファ槽内の多孔捕集手段で異物が捕集され異物を除去されたバッファ槽内の水は循環機構18の戻し管48、ポンプ50、噴射管28を経由して再び手洗い槽12内に噴射される。このように、コンパクトな構造で常時清浄な水流槽を保持し、葉物等の洗浄を効率よく行える。したがって、手洗い槽12内に洗浄対象物を両手で把持してそのまま速い流れの中に漬けた状態で手揉み洗いができ、簡易な洗浄を効果的に行える。また、単なる大型槽内にホース口を垂らした滞留循環などではなく、オーバフロー部や横長スリット孔等の異物捕集補助手段並びにそれらの捕集手段によりほぼ完全に塵埃や異物除去後の水を循環させるから常にフレッシュな水が供給されており、異物除去を確実に行わせうる。 Next, the operation of the hand-washing machine for fruit foods and the like according to the embodiment will be described with reference to FIG. 5 as well. , 30 is caused to eject the washing water W in the lateral direction. In the hand-washing tank 12, as shown in FIG. 1, the spray cleaning water from the cross spray nozzles 26a, 26b is sprayed so as to come into contact with the upper surface of the bottom wall. And it collides in the near side of the opposing wall 24b, it becomes a turbulent state, and a flow strikes the substantially whole surface of the inner surface side of the opposing wall 24b. Therefore, the flow hitting the facing wall 24b consumes energy to some extent, and water near the water surface is discharged from the overflow portion 34, and water near the bottom wall is discharged from the slit hole 36 toward the buffer tank 15. Furthermore, in the embodiment, the parallel jet nozzles 30a and 30b create a flow in which the vicinity of the water surface is jetted in parallel toward the opposing wall 24b, thereby strengthening the unidirectional flow. And a fast flow in one direction can be made in a tank, without making a stay and a circulation flow form in a hand-washing tank. In this state, for example, when leaf vegetables are immersed in the hand-washing tank 12, for example, by hand-washing, the foreign matters are surely separated by the water flow, and hair and algae R foreign matters that are likely to float on the surface of light specific gravity overflow from the overflow portion 34. At the same time, foreign matters such as sand particles S having a relatively large specific gravity are present near the bottom wall and are reliably discharged from the slit hole 36 toward the buffer tank. Then, the water in the buffer tank from which foreign matter has been collected and removed by the porous collecting means in the buffer tank passes through the return pipe 48 of the circulation mechanism 18, the pump 50, and the injection pipe 28, and again in the hand-washing tank 12. Is injected into. In this way, a clean water flow tank is always maintained with a compact structure, and leaves can be washed efficiently. Therefore, the object to be cleaned can be held in the hand-washing tank 12 with both hands, and can be washed in a state where it is immersed in a fast flow as it is, and simple cleaning can be effectively performed. In addition, it is not a mere circulation of hose that hangs in a large tank, but foreign matter collecting auxiliary means such as overflow part and horizontally long slit hole, and those collecting means circulate water after removing dust and foreign matter almost completely. Therefore, fresh water is always supplied, and foreign matter removal can be surely performed.

参考実施形態Reference embodiment

次に、図7ないし図9に基づいて、本発明の参考実施形態としての果菜食品等の手洗い機10−1について説明するが、上記した第1実施形態と同一部材には同一符号を付しその詳細な説明は省略する。この参考実施形態では噴射手段14として平行噴射ノズル30a、30bだけを設け交差噴射ノズル26a、26bは設けられていない。一方、手洗い槽12の底壁22には開口70,72が設けられ、これらは排出パイプ74に連通してバッファ槽15の上位室151側に排出されるようになっている。詳しくは底壁22の水流れ中間位置の平坦部222並びに傾斜部221に略全幅にわたり横長角柱状に凹設する長溝ポケット701、721が形成され、それらの中央位置にそれぞれ排出開口70,72が設けられそれらの開口70,72が排出パイプ74に共通に連通されている。これによって、底壁に沈むおそれの高い水中でのより高比重成分を捕集して該排出パイプ74から排出させる。 Next, based on FIG. 7 thru | or FIG. 9, although the hand washing machine 10-1 for fruit vegetables etc. as reference embodiment of this invention is demonstrated, the same code | symbol is attached | subjected to the same member as above-mentioned 1st Embodiment. Detailed description thereof is omitted. In this reference embodiment , only the parallel injection nozzles 30a and 30b are provided as the injection means 14, and the cross injection nozzles 26a and 26b are not provided. On the other hand, openings 70 and 72 are provided in the bottom wall 22 of the hand-washing tank 12, which communicate with a discharge pipe 74 and are discharged to the upper chamber 151 side of the buffer tank 15. Specifically, long groove pockets 701 and 721 are formed in the flat portion 222 and the inclined portion 221 at the middle position of the water flow of the bottom wall 22 so as to be recessed in a horizontally long rectangular column shape over substantially the entire width. These openings 70 and 72 are provided in common communication with the discharge pipe 74. As a result, a higher specific gravity component in water that is highly likely to sink to the bottom wall is collected and discharged from the discharge pipe 74.

さらに、この参考実施形態において、放出部16は、対向壁24bの上端部に設けた前記オーバフロー部34と、下端部に設けた前記スリット孔36と、に加え、さらに高さ方向中間部に形成した中間開口と、を含む。中間開口76は略同じ高さレベルで横に等距離離隔して設けられた円形孔からなり、バッファ槽15側に突出して中空台形状の放出ノズル78がそれぞれ突設されている。放出ノズル78は横方向に放出される水がバッファ槽内で下方に向けて急に曲げられるように断面上部の周面が斜め下がり状にテーパ壁として形成されている。また、スリット孔36は、それぞれ離隔して4個配置されている。スリット孔36は、手洗い槽12の略横幅全長にわたって1個のみのスリット孔を設けてもよいし、2,3,4個あるいは6個以上の複数個設置してもよい。 Furthermore, in this reference embodiment , the discharge part 16 is formed in the intermediate part in the height direction in addition to the overflow part 34 provided in the upper end part of the opposing wall 24b and the slit hole 36 provided in the lower end part. An intermediate opening. The intermediate opening 76 is formed by circular holes provided at substantially the same height level and spaced apart at an equal distance from each other. A hollow trapezoidal discharge nozzle 78 projects from the buffer tank 15 side. In the discharge nozzle 78, the peripheral surface of the upper section is formed as a tapered wall so as to be inclined downward so that the water discharged in the lateral direction is suddenly bent downward in the buffer tank. In addition, four slit holes 36 are arranged apart from each other. The slit hole 36 may be provided with only one slit hole over the substantially entire lateral width of the hand-washing tank 12, or may be installed in a number of 2, 3, 4 or 6 or more.

この参考実施形態では、洗浄水は平行噴射ノズル30a、30bから対向壁24b側に噴出され、図上、左から右方向への水流を生起させる。その際、対向壁24b付近において、軽比重の水面近くに浮遊する異物はオーバフロー部34から溢流水とともにバッファ槽側に排出される。また、水中の中間で浮遊する異物、例えば塵埃、ナイロン屑、毛髪等は同じくバッファ槽側に排出される。砂等の完全に槽体の底壁面に沈む異物は、図8のように若干の循環流により底壁の流れ中間側に戻されたとしても底壁の開口70,72から吸引されて排出パイプ74を介してバッファ槽側に排出される。また、対向壁24b付近の砂成分等はスリット孔36から吸引排出される。対向壁24bの内側で浮遊しオーバフロー部34あるいはスリット孔36のいずれからも排出し得ない異物は、高さ中間位置に設けた中間開口76、放出ノズル78を介してバッファ槽15側に排出される。 In this reference embodiment , the wash water is jetted from the parallel jet nozzles 30a and 30b toward the opposing wall 24b, and causes a water flow from the left to the right in the drawing. At that time, the foreign matter floating near the light surface of the light specific gravity near the facing wall 24b is discharged from the overflow part 34 to the buffer tank side along with the overflow water. Further, foreign matters floating in the middle of the water, such as dust, nylon scraps, hair, etc., are also discharged to the buffer tank side. Even if the foreign matter that completely sinks on the bottom wall surface of the tank body, such as sand, is returned to the middle of the bottom wall by a slight circulating flow as shown in FIG. 8, it is sucked and discharged from the openings 70 and 72 of the bottom wall. It is discharged to the buffer tank side via the pipe 74. Further, sand components and the like in the vicinity of the facing wall 24b are sucked and discharged from the slit hole 36. Foreign matter that floats inside the opposing wall 24b and cannot be discharged from either the overflow portion 34 or the slit hole 36 is discharged to the buffer tank 15 side through an intermediate opening 76 and a discharge nozzle 78 provided at an intermediate height.
